Troubleshooting your dock
Your dock will tell you if something is wrong via the LED indicators on the top of
the dock. If the dock is not performing as expected, check the iRobot Home app

for errors.
Clean Tank LED indicator
Solid red: clean tank empty, missing, or improperly installed
1
Fill the tank if it is empty with water or compatible cleaning solution.
2
Make sure the tank is installed properly.
Dirty Tank LED indicator
Solid red: dirty tank full, missing, or improperly installed
1
Empty the tank if it is full.
2
Make sure the tank is installed properly.
Dirt Disposal LED indicator
Solid red: bag full, missing, or improperly installed; debris drawer
improperly installed
1
Replace bag if it is full or missing.
2
Make sure the bag is securely inserted and debris drawer is installed
properly.

Dirt Disposal LED indicator (continued)
Flashing red: clog in the dock evacuation path
1
With your robot on the dock, hold the Clean button down for 2-5 seconds or
use the iRobot Home App to manually empty the bin
Proceed to step 2 if the error is not resolved.
2
Remove the bin from your robot. Clear any debris from the bin and Debris
Evacuation Port. Reinstall the bin.
Push down the Debris Evacuation Port on the dock, and ensure there are no
obstructions in the path. Remove any visible debris.
Repeat step 1. Proceed to step 3 if the error is not resolved.
